What does the word "Maba" mean?

The term "Maba" can have various meanings depending on the context in which it is used. This article delves into the different connotations, cultural significance, and usages of the word across different regions and languages.

1. In Indonesian culture: In Indonesia, "Maba" is commonly known as an acronym for "Mahasiswa Baru," which translates to "new students." This term is particularly significant in the educational context as it refers to students who have just enrolled in universities or colleges. The transitional phase from high school to higher education is marked by various orientations and activities designed to help these new students acclimate to university life.
